C++初心者が荷物運びゲームをつくってみた

/* | |
平山尚『ゲームプログラマになる前に覚えておきたい技術』より | |
お題:荷物運びゲームを2時間以内につくる | |
*/ | |
#include<iostream> | |
using namespace std; | |
char screen[5][8] = { | |
{'#', '#', '#', '#', '#', '#', '#', '#',}, | |
{'#', ' ', '.', '.', ' ', 'p', ' ', '#',}, | |
{'#', ' ', 'o', 'o', ' ', ' ', ' ', '#',}, | |
{'#', ' ', ' ', ' ', ' ', ' ', ' ', '#',}, | |
{'#', '#', '#', '#', '#', '#', '#', '#',}, | |
}; | |
char input; | |
int x, y; | |
bool cleared = false; | |
void getInput() { | |
cin >> input; | |
} | |
void setPosition() { | |
for (int i = 0; i < 5; i++) { | |
for (int j = 0; j < 8; j++) { | |
if (screen[i][j] == 'p' || screen[i][j] == 'P') { | |
x = j; | |
y = i; | |
} | |
} | |
} | |
} | |
bool isGoalPoint(int rx, int ry) { | |
if ((ry == 1 && rx == 2) || (ry == 1 && rx == 3)) { | |
return true; | |
} | |
return false; | |
} | |
void setCleared() { | |
if (screen[1][2] == 'O' && screen[1][3] == 'O') { | |
cleared = true; | |
} | |
} | |
void move(int rx, int ry, char c) { | |
if (c == '#') { | |
return; | |
} | |
else if (c == ' ') { | |
screen[ry][rx] = 'p'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
else if (c == '.') { | |
screen[ry][rx] = 'P'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
else if (c == 'o' || c == 'O') { | |
int rxx, ryy; | |
if (input == 'a') { | |
rxx = rx - 1; | |
ryy = ry; | |
} | |
else if (input == 's') { | |
rxx = rx + 1; | |
ryy = ry; | |
} | |
else if (input == 'w') { | |
rxx = rx; | |
ryy = ry - 1; | |
} | |
else if (input == 'z') { | |
rxx = rx; | |
ryy = ry + 1; | |
} | |
if (screen[ryy][rxx] == '#' || screen[ryy][rxx] == 'o') { | |
return; | |
} | |
else if (screen[ryy][rxx] == ' ') { | |
screen[ryy][rxx] = 'o'; | |
if (isGoalPoint(rx, ry)) { | |
screen[ry][rx] = 'P'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
else { | |
screen[ry][rx] = 'p'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
} | |
else if (screen[ryy][rxx] == '.') { | |
screen[ryy][rxx] = 'O'; | |
if (isGoalPoint(rx, ry)) { | |
screen[ry][rx] = 'P'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
else { | |
screen[ry][rx] = 'p'; | |
if (screen[y][x] == 'P') { | |
screen[y][x] = '.'; | |
} | |
else { | |
screen[y][x] = ' '; | |
} | |
} | |
} | |
else if (screen[ryy][rxx] == ' ') { | |
screen[ryy][rxx] = 'o'; | |
} | |
} | |
} | |
void updateGame() { | |
int rx, ry = 0; | |
char c; | |
setPosition(); | |
if (input == 'a') { | |
rx = x - 1; | |
ry = y; | |
c = screen[ry][rx]; | |
move(rx, ry, c); | |
} | |
else if (input == 's') { | |
rx = x + 1; | |
ry = y; | |
c = screen[ry][rx]; | |
move(rx, ry, c); | |
} | |
else if (input == 'w') { | |
rx = x; | |
ry = y - 1; | |
c = screen[ry][rx]; | |
move(rx, ry, c); | |
} | |
else if (input == 'z') { | |
rx = x; | |
ry = y + 1; | |
c = screen[ry][rx]; | |
move(rx, ry, c); | |
} | |
else { | |
return; | |
} | |
setCleared(); | |
} | |
void draw() { | |
for (int i = 0; i < 5; i++) { | |
for (int j = 0; j < 8; j++) { | |
cout << screen[i][j]; | |
} | |
cout << endl; | |
} | |
if (cleared) { | |
cout << "Congratulation's! you won." << endl; | |
} | |
else { | |
cout << "a:left s:right w:up z:down. command?" << endl; | |
} | |
} | |
int main() { | |
draw(); | |
while (true) { | |
if (cleared) continue; | |
getInput(); | |
updateGame(); | |
draw(); | |
} | |
} |
